SIM Card Options at Lagos LOS Airport

At Lagos LOS airport, also known as Murtala Muhammed Airport, travelers can usually find SIM card counters or kiosks operated by Nigeria’s major mobile providers. The most common names you’ll encounter are MTN Nigeria, Airtel Nigeria, Glo, and 9mobile. Travelers can purchase SIM cards from major providers at airport shops and convenience stores located throughout Murtala Muhammed Airport, with clear signage indicating mobile service providers. MTN is often considered the strongest in terms of nationwide coverage, while Airtel is popular for competitive data bundles.

These SIM cards are typically prepaid and marketed toward tourists with short-term data packages. Prices vary depending on data volume and validity, but travelers should expect to pay the equivalent of around 10 to 35 USD for a starter package, sometimes more at airport pricing. Why Airport SIM Cards Often Slow You Down

The first challenge is waiting. Lagos airport can be busy, and SIM card counters are no exception. Queues build quickly, and after a long-haul flight, standing in line is rarely how travelers want to spend their first moments in Nigeria.

Next comes mandatory registration. Nigerian regulations require SIM cards to be registered using valid identification. This means handing over your passport, having details entered into a system, and waiting for confirmation. If systems are slow or staff are overwhelmed, this step alone can take longer than expected.

Currency can also become an issue. While some counters accept cards, cash in Nigerian naira is often preferred. If you haven’t exchanged money yet, you may need to visit a currency exchange first, adding another queue to your arrival routine.

Activation delays are another common frustration. Some SIM cards do not activate instantly, requiring restarts or waiting periods. During this time, you may still be offline, relying on crowded airport WiFi that isn’t always reliable.

Finally, using a physical SIM means removing your home SIM card. To use a local SIM or eSIM, you need an unlocked phone and a compatible device, otherwise activation may not be possible. This can disrupt access to important SMS messages, banking alerts, and verification codes—small details that matter, especially when traveling internationally.
